Hotels Near Feijenoord Stadium, Rotterdam

Feijenoord Stadium, better known as De Kuip, stands as an iconic symbol of Rotterdam’s vibrant sports culture and architectural ingenuity. Opened in 1937, this legendary football stadium is home to Feyenoord Rotterdam, one of the Netherlands’ most celebrated football clubs. With a seating capacity approaching 51,000, De Kuip has witnessed countless historic matches, including European finals, World Cup qualifiers, and domestic championships. Its semi-elliptical shape was revolutionary at the time of construction, setting a new standard for stadium design, and its intimate atmosphere ensures fans feel intricately connected to the energy of the game.

Visitors to Feijenoord Stadium can enjoy more than just attending matches. Guided tours offer a behind-the-scenes glimpse into the locker rooms, VIP lounges, press areas, and pitchside views, bringing to life decades of sporting heritage. Booking a guided tour in advance is recommended, especially during peak football seasons from August to May, when demand surges. Off-season visits often provide a quieter experience and allow time for exploring multi-media exhibitions that celebrate the club’s rich past. Those who arrive on match days should anticipate a lively, bustling atmosphere; arriving early is wise for soaking in the pre-game excitement and securing the best transport options.

Choosing accommodation near Feijenoord Stadium depends largely on your travel priorities. For football fans aiming to immerse themselves fully, staying in the neighborhood of Feijenoord or nearby Katendrecht offers the convenience of walking to the stadium and enjoying local eateries famed for their authentic Dutch and international fare. Business travelers or those who plan to explore Rotterdam’s broader cultural offerings might prefer hotels closer to the city center, which is a short tram ride away and features a wider range of boutique hotels and serviced apartments. Many accommodations in Rotterdam provide excellent public transport links, making it easy to combine a stadium visit with sightseeing trips to landmarks like the Erasmus Bridge or the Museum Boijmans Van Beuningen.

When selecting your stay, consider your balance between convenience and ambiance. Apartments or inns in nearby residential quarters often provide a more authentic and relaxed Rotterdam experience, perfect for travelers looking to blend match day with local life. Meanwhile, larger hotels with conference facilities might better suit visitors attending events at De Kuip beyond football, such as concerts or business gatherings. Whether you’re here for sport, culture, or business, the area around Feijenoord Stadium offers a welcoming base that captures the dynamic spirit of one of Europe’s most passionate football cities.
